There’s something irresistible about the sizzle of steak hitting a hot pan, especially when it’s bathed in garlic butter and finished with a shower of freshly grated Parmesan. These Garlic Parmesan Steak Bites with Mashed Potatoes are the kind of dish that turns an ordinary evening into something special—without the fuss of a complicated recipe.

The first time I made this, it was a spontaneous weeknight dinner when I had a lone sirloin in the fridge and a craving for comfort food. With creamy mashed potatoes as the base and juicy steak bites on top, it quickly earned a permanent place in our dinner rotation. It’s fast, filling, and downright craveable.
Whether you’re looking for a family-friendly dinner, a date night treat, or just something deliciously different, this recipe delivers. Let’s dive in.
Why You’ll Love This Garlic Parmesan Steak Bites Recipe
Get ready to fall in love with a meal that checks all the boxes: bold flavors, minimal effort, and serious comfort.
First off, it’s a total time-saver. You can whip this dish up in about 30 minutes, start to finish. Perfect for those busy nights when you want something hearty without spending hours in the kitchen.
It’s also incredibly budget-friendly. You don’t need fancy cuts of beef to make this shine—sirloin or even top round works beautifully. Paired with pantry staples like garlic, butter, and potatoes, it’s a meal that feels indulgent without blowing your grocery budget.
Flavor-wise, it’s unbeatable. The garlic butter sears into the steak, while the Parmesan adds a salty, umami-rich finish. Served over ultra-creamy mashed potatoes? Heaven on a plate.
And don’t forget the versatility. You can switch up the potatoes for cauliflower mash, swap in chicken for the steak, or even serve it over rice. This recipe is as adaptable as your cravings.
Whether you're cooking for yourself or feeding a crew, this dish is sure to impress. Let’s break down what you’ll need.
Ingredients Notes

This recipe keeps it simple with a handful of well-chosen ingredients that each play a critical role in the final dish.
Steak is the star of the show. I usually go for sirloin—it’s affordable, tender, and cooks quickly. If you prefer something even richer, ribeye or New York strip work beautifully too. Just be sure to cut the meat into evenly sized bites so they sear properly.
Garlic brings the signature punch to these steak bites. Fresh minced garlic is best here—you’ll want 4 to 5 cloves. It infuses the butter and steak with deep, aromatic flavor that makes the whole dish sing.
Parmesan cheese takes things to the next level. Go for freshly grated Parmesan, not the pre-shredded kind. It melts more evenly and gives you that nutty, salty finish that makes each bite irresistible.
Potatoes form the creamy base. I recommend using Yukon Golds or Russets, as they mash beautifully. Add butter, cream, and a touch of garlic to make them smooth, rich, and flavorful enough to stand on their own—but even better under those steak bites.
You’ll also want unsalted butter, olive oil, heavy cream, salt and pepper, and a sprinkle of parsley for garnish. No fancy tools required—just a good skillet, a large pot for boiling potatoes, and a potato masher or hand mixer.
How To Make This Garlic Parmesan Steak Bites With Mashed Potatoes

Creating this comfort-packed dish is easier than you think. Here's how to bring it all together step by step.
Start by prepping your potatoes. Peel and chop them into evenly sized chunks and get them boiling in salted water. Let them simmer until fork-tender—about 15 minutes—while you work on the steak.
Next, pat your steak pieces dry with paper towels. This is key to getting a nice sear. Heat a large skillet over medium-high and add a tablespoon each of butter and olive oil. Once the butter is melted and bubbling, add your steak in a single layer. Let them sear undisturbed for 2-3 minutes before flipping.
Once the steak is browned on all sides and just cooked through, remove it to a plate. In the same skillet, reduce the heat to medium and add your minced garlic. Stir constantly for about 30 seconds until fragrant—careful not to let it burn!
Add the steak bites back to the pan along with the rest of the butter and stir to coat everything in that rich garlic butter. Finish with a generous handful of grated Parmesan cheese, tossing until it melts and clings to the meat.
Meanwhile, drain your tender potatoes and return them to the pot. Add butter, cream, salt, and a pinch of garlic powder if desired. Mash until smooth and creamy. Taste and adjust for seasoning.
Spoon a hearty mound of mashed potatoes onto each plate, then pile on the steak bites. Finish with a sprinkle of parsley and a little extra Parmesan for good measure.
From start to finish, this recipe takes about 30–35 minutes—and every second is worth it.
Storage Options
If you have leftovers (which is rare in my house!), they store beautifully for another meal.
Refrigerate any extra steak bites and mashed potatoes in separate airtight containers. They’ll keep well in the fridge for up to 3 days.
For longer storage, you can freeze the mashed potatoes, though the texture may change slightly after thawing. Let them cool completely, then transfer to a freezer-safe bag or container. Freeze for up to 1 month.
Reheating is simple: warm the steak bites in a skillet over medium heat with a splash of beef broth or butter to keep them moist. Reheat the mashed potatoes on the stovetop or in the microwave, stirring in a bit of cream or milk to restore their smoothness.
Variations and Substitutions
This recipe is wonderfully flexible, so don’t be afraid to make it your own.
If you're not a fan of red meat, chicken breast or thighs make a great substitute. Cube them up and follow the same method—you’ll still get plenty of garlicky, cheesy goodness.
Want to lighten things up? Try cauliflower mash instead of traditional potatoes. It cuts carbs without sacrificing that creamy texture we all love.
Add some veggies into the mix! A quick sauté of zucchini, mushrooms, or asparagus in the same garlic butter pan adds extra flavor and color.
Craving spice? A pinch of red pepper flakes or a dash of hot sauce in the garlic butter gives the dish a subtle kick.
You can even make it keto-friendly by skipping the mashed potatoes and serving the steak bites over zoodles or sautéed spinach. It’s still rich, satisfying, and full of flavor.
The best part about this recipe is how forgiving it is. No matter what you swap in or out, you’ll still end up with a dish that’s cozy, comforting, and totally delicious. Don’t be afraid to experiment—you might just stumble on your own new favorite version.
PrintGarlic Parmesan Steak Bites With Mashed Potatoes Recipe
This Garlic Parmesan Steak Bites With Mashed Potatoes recipe combines tender, juicy steak with rich garlic butter and parmesan, paired perfectly with creamy mashed potatoes. Ideal for weeknight dinners or a satisfying weekend meal, it's a crowd-pleasing dish full of bold flavors and comforting textures.
- Prep Time: 15 minutes
- Cook Time: 25 minutes
- Total Time: 40 minutes
- Yield: 4 servings 1x
- Category: Dinner
- Method: Stovetop
- Cuisine: American
- Diet: Gluten Free
Ingredients
For the Steak Bites:
-
1½ lbs sirloin steak, cut into bite-sized pieces
-
4 cloves garlic, minced
-
2 tbsp olive oil
-
2 tbsp butter
-
¼ cup grated parmesan cheese
-
Salt and pepper to taste
-
1 tsp Italian seasoning
-
Fresh parsley (for garnish)
For the Mashed Potatoes:
-
2 lbs Yukon gold potatoes, peeled and cubed
-
½ cup milk
-
¼ cup butter
-
Salt and pepper to taste
-
Optional: 2 cloves garlic, minced
Instructions
-
Prepare Potatoes: Boil cubed potatoes in salted water until tender. Drain and mash with butter, milk, and season to taste.
-
Cook Steak Bites: Season steak with salt, pepper, and Italian seasoning.
-
Sear Steak: Heat olive oil in a skillet over medium-high heat. Sear steak bites for 2–3 minutes until browned. Remove and set aside.
-
Garlic Butter Sauce: In the same pan, melt butter and sauté garlic. Return steak to pan, toss with garlic butter, then sprinkle parmesan over top.
-
Serve: Plate steak bites over mashed potatoes and garnish with parsley.
Notes
-
For extra flavor, add a splash of Worcestershire sauce while cooking the steak.
-
Yukon gold potatoes offer the best creamy texture for mashing.
-
Adjust garlic and parmesan levels to taste.
Nutrition
- Serving Size: 1 plate (¼ of recipe)
- Calories: 610
- Sugar: 2g
- Sodium: 520mg
Leave a Reply